Head to head

Ranks are only compared within one published list and one year. Two ranks from different years, from a boys' and a girls' list, or from different registrars are not comparable, so they are not placed side by side.

  • Northern Ireland · Girls

    In 2023, Emily was ranked #4 and Laurie #391 among girls in Northern Ireland.

  • Republic of Ireland · Girls

    In 2024, Emily was ranked #4 and Laurie #736 among girls in Republic of Ireland.

  • England and Wales · Girls

    In 2025, Emily was ranked #44 and Laurie #2006 among girls in England and Wales.

List by list

  • England and Wales · Girls30 shared years, 19962025

    Emily held the stronger position in 30 of those years, Laurie in 0.

    Highest recorded here: Emily #1 in 2003, Laurie #478 in 1997.

    The order between them never changed and held in this list.

    Most recent shared year, 2025: Emily #44, Laurie #2006.

  • Republic of Ireland · Girls30 shared years, 19642024

    Emily held the stronger position in 30 of those years, Laurie in 0.

    Highest recorded here: Emily #1 in 2011, Laurie #303 in 1990.

    The order between them never changed and held in this list.

    Most recent shared year, 2024: Emily #4, Laurie #736.
